The correct answer is option 3. Allotrope of Carbon. Graphene is an allotrope of carbon. Allotrope: Allotropy refers to the existence of an element in two or more different forms, or allotropes, in the same physical state. In the case of carbon, it can exist in various forms, including diamond, graphite, fullerenes, and graphene. Each of these forms has distinct structural arrangements of carbon atoms. Carbon is a chemical element with the symbol "C" and atomic number 6. It is known for its versatility and ability to form strong bonds with other carbon atoms and various elements. Graphene: Graphene is a single layer of carbon atoms arranged in a two-dimensional honeycomb lattice. It is incredibly thin, strong, lightweight, and has remarkable electrical and thermal conductivity properties. Graphene is considered one of the most promising materials for various applications, including electronics, energy storage, biomedical devices, and more. |
